Doctoral regalia is more than just a robe; it’s a "scholarly fingerprint".
The most personalized piece. The velvet trim color represents your academic discipline (e.g., Dark Blue for PhD, Light Blue for Education, Purple for Law), while the satin lining displays your university's colors .
